The airship Comet represents an early non-rigid dirigible, characteristic of the pioneering era of aviation in the early 20th century, likely between 1900 and 1915. These craft were often built and operated by independent aviators, such as Roy Knabenshue in the United States, for exhibition flights and public demonstrations. The man seen walking on a suspended framework beneath the envelope suggests a daring aerial performance, a common spectacle designed to draw crowds and showcase the novelty of powered flight.
